When choosing the right vest, it is often the length, sleeves and everyday use that make the difference. Some children feel best in a close-fitting style as an extra layer, while others do well with a more classic vest that adds gentle warmth around the upper body.
Many parents look for Name It vests because the brand is known for its conscious approach to organic cotton and gentler material choices. It is not only about how the cotton is grown, but also about how the fabric feels against the skin when the clothing is worn for many hours at a time.
A skin-friendly Name It vest can therefore be a good choice if your child is easily bothered by rough seams, synthetic fibres or fabrics that feel harsh against the skin. The vest will not treat skin concerns in itself, but it can help make everyday dressing more comfortable by reducing irritation from the clothing your child wears closest to the body or as an extra layer.
This is also where Name It stands apart from many more heavily printed and decorative children’s brands. The look is simple, with fewer elements that may distract or irritate. For a child with sensitive skin, those small details can actually be noticeable during a long day at nursery, school or at home.
When choosing a Name It vest, the material is one of the most important things to consider. Many styles are made from organic cotton, and some are also GOTS certified. In practice, this means materials where both process and content have been considered, helping to avoid unnecessarily harsh chemicals in production.
For children with delicate skin, cotton is often a comfortable choice because it is soft, breathable and pleasant close to the body. Name It’s designs are usually kept simple too, with minimal seams, calm surfaces and no details that may scratch or bother the skin. This makes the vests especially useful as a layer under tops, bodysuits or nightwear.

The right choice depends mainly on how much coverage the vest should provide and how it will be used during the day.
A shorter or more classic Name It vest is a good choice if you want a light layer over the upper body underneath a top or sweatshirt. This type works well for children who may not have very sensitive skin, but who still feel most comfortable in a soft cotton quality for everyday wear.
A more covering style with long sleeves or a cut similar to a bodysuit may be a better choice for children whose skin reacts easily, and where you want to protect more of the body from friction caused by other clothing. Here, the fit is important. It should sit close enough to work as an inner layer, but still feel comfortable enough for play and movement.
As a rule of thumb, vests often become especially relevant from around 6 months and up, when your child starts moving more and layering becomes more practical in everyday life. If you are unsure whether a closer-fitting inner layer would work better, it may also be worth looking at bodysuits as an alternative or supplement.
